      genirq: Remove irq argument from irq flow handlers · bd0b9ac4
      Thomas Gleixner 提交于
      Most interrupt flow handlers do not use the irq argument. Those few
      which use it can retrieve the irq number from the irq descriptor.
      
      Remove the argument.
      
      Search and replace was done with coccinelle and some extra helper
      scripts around it. Thanks to Julia for her help!

      PCI/keystone: Fix race in installing chained IRQ handler · 2cf5a03c
      Thomas Gleixner 提交于
      Fix a race where a pending interrupt could be received and the handler
      called before the handler's data has been setup, by converting to
      irq_set_chained_handler_and_data().
      
      Search and conversion was done with coccinelle:
      
      @@
      expression E1, E2, E3;
      @@
      (
      -if (irq_set_chained_handler(E1, E3) != 0)
      -   BUG();
      |
      -irq_set_chained_handler(E1, E3);
      )
      -irq_set_handler_data(E1, E2);
      +irq_set_chained_handler_and_data(E1, E3, E2);
      
      @@
      expression E1, E2, E3;
      @@
      (
      -if (irq_set_chained_handler(E1, E3) != 0)
      -   BUG();
      ...
      |
      -irq_set_chained_handler(E1, E3);
      ...
      )
      -irq_set_handler_data(E1, E2);
      +irq_set_chained_handler_and_data(E1, E3, E2);

      PCI: keystone: Add TI Keystone PCIe driver · 0c4ffcfe
      Murali Karicheri 提交于
      The Keystone PCIe controller is based on v3.65 version of the Designware
      h/w.  Main differences are:
      
          1. No ATU support
          2. Legacy and MSI IRQ functions are implemented in application register
             space
          3. MSI interrupts are multiplexed over 8 IRQ lines to the Host side.
      
      All of the application register space handing code is organized into
      pci-keystone-dw.c and the functions are called from pci-keystone.c to
      implement PCI controller driver.  Also add necessary DT documentation and
      update the MAINTAINERS file for the driver.
